Black-and-White photograph postcard showing the Reid Nurses Home building at Trudeau Sanatorium. There is an "x" in black ink over the dormer window at the top right of the building, and a small stick figure of a nurse has been drawn in the car parked out front. Printed caption on front reads, "Reid House, Trudeau, NY." Printed by the $5-Photo-Co., Canton, NY. Used, divided back, white border, postmarked Trudeau, NY, July 7, 1953.
Handwritten message on reverse reads, "Monday- Dear Nan- First, save all these postcards- so I'll have a collection- oke? This is one residence- x marks our room- continues thru to the back. Rec'd your letter- believe me, it was great to hear from you again- have you done anything to the cypress [?]? Here, they have a workshop & we're going down & make a pot or something, also work [?] leather, metal, paint, & everything. Rest in letter- Love & hugs, DJ [?]." Mailed to Miss Nancy Ross, Breesport, NY.Subject Place
